Acceder a las particiones windows desde ubuntu (NTFS)

Imagen de Eleesban
0 puntos

Hola, acabo de instalar la versión de ubuntu que me han enviado a casa (6.06 LTS), funciona todo perfectamente, pero no consigo entrar en las particiones de windows(NTFS), al intentar acceder me sale una ventana que dice "imposible montar el volumen seleccionado". Que es que no puedo acceder de ninguna manera a esas particiones?, para escuchar los archivos de música o ver fotos.
Creo recordar que cuando tube suse instalado podía acceder a las carpetas de windows y reproducir música y vídeos.
Un saludo

Imagen de birraboy
+1
0
-1

Tipico problema, yo tambien lo tube, te paso un manual a través del cual vas a poder incluso escribir en dichas particiones.

1. Instalación

Lo primero que se necesita es añadir uno de los dos siguientes repositorios a nuestro sources.list, para lo cual tecleamos.

$ sudo gedit /etc/apt/sources.list

Y añadimos al final del fichero lo siguiente

## Linux-NTFS Givre's repository (ntfs-3g & fuse 2.5.3)
deb http://givre.cabspace.com/ubuntu/ dapper main
deb-src http://givre.cabspace.com/ubuntu/ dapper main

o bien

## Linux-NTFS (ntfs-3g & fuse 2.5.3)
deb http://flomertens.keo.in/ubuntu/ dapper main
deb-src http://flomertens.keo.in/ubuntu/ dapper main

Actualizamos nuestro sistema

$ sudo apt-get update
$ sudo apt-get upgrade

E instalamos todo con una sola orden

$ sudo apt-get install ntfs-3g

2. Configuración

Para este paso asumiremos que no hay ninguna partición NTFS en modo sólo lectura previamente montada en el sistema, por lo que si la tiene es necesario que la desmonte, bien con el botón derecho del ratón sobre el icono de la unidad en el escritorio y pulsando en 'Desmontar volumen', bien mediante la correspondiente orden umount.

Cuando esté todo instalado correctamente, necesitaremos configurar la partición NTFS para que sea montada mediante ntfs-3g. Por tanto, hemos de saber el nombre de la tal partición.

$ sudo fdisk -l | grep NTFS

Lo que nos dará al menos una línea con un aspecto similar al siguiente

/dev/hda1 1 3902 31342783+ 7 HPFS/NTFS

Por tanto, nuestra partición será hda1, y la montaremos en /media/winXP, para lo cual hemos primero de crear dicho directorio (si no estuviese ya creado)

$ sudo mkdir /media/winXP

Ahora modificaremos el fichero /etc/fstab para que monte la partición en cada reinicio

$ sudo gedit /etc/fstab

Y añadimos la línea

/dev/hda1 /media/winXP ntfs-3g silent,umask=0,locale=es_ES.utf8,no_def_opts,allow_other 0 0

Si ya existiese una orden para montar en /media/winXP la partición /dev/hda1 con nfs habría que sustituirla por la anterior.

Las localizaciones que podemos usar a la hora de montar la unidad se corresponden con la salida de este comando, en nuestro caso hemos usado es_ES.utf8

$ sudo cat /var/lib/locales/supported.d/local

Para termirnar, necesitamos cargar fuse en cada reinicio, para lo cual hemos de añadir una línea con la palabra fuse al final del fichero /etc/modules. Por tanto

$ sudo gedit /etc/modules

Y añadimos fuse al final. Ya está listo, si queremos verlo en acción bastará con teclear

$ sudo modprobe fuse
$ sudo umount -a
$ sudo mount -a

Más fácil imposible.

4. Usando NTFS en dispositivos USB

Puede que tengamos algún dispositivo de almacenamiento que trabaje con NTFS pero que estemos conectando y desconectando con asiduidad, por lo que no podremos añadirlo al /etc/fstab. Para ello una solución puede ser añadir un script en Nautilus que permita montar esos dispositivos con ntfs-3g, en lugar del driver habitual con el que lo hace Ubuntu, de manera que al pulsar con el botón derecho del ratón sobre el dispositivo USB, nos aparecerán dos opciones en Scripts, Scripts -> mount_with_ntfs-3g para re-montar la unidad con permisos de lectura y escritura, y Scripts -> unmount_ntfs-3g para desmontarla.

$ sudo apt-get install ntfs-3g-nautilus-tool
$ nautilus-script-manager enable mount_with_ntfs-3g
$ nautilus-script-manager enable unmount_ntfs-3g

Y esto es todo, no dejen de pasarse por al artículo original en caso de experimentar algún problema.

+1
0
-1
Imagen de Leolo
+1
0
-1

Hola, a tod@s, de todas formas yo no recomendaría usar el driver ntfs-3g para escribir en NTFS por que está todavia algo "verde", si tiene cosas importantes en la partición no es plan de jugársela por escribir en NTFS y por que tiene algunas limitaciones como:

- Acceder a ficheros encriptados
- Escribir ficheros comprimidos
- Cambiar propietarios y permisos en ficheros

Ademas tambien se dice que no se puede mas de una partición NTFS montada con ntfs-3g

+1
0
-1
Imagen de Anónimo
+1
0
-1

hola leolo, pude montar dos particiones ntfs con xp dañado por virus, y por fin tuve acceso a un montón de archivos que quería migrar a mi ubunto drapper.

+1
0
-1
Imagen de caballo
+1
0
-1

Gracias por ayudar a los nuevos ya estoy configurando mi ubuntu de la manera como muestra en este tutorial solo que me dice que las unidades estan ocupadas

reiniciare y luego te cuento, de todas maneras muchas gracias

Saludos desde petèn Guatemala

Si eres bueno buscad lo bueno

+1
0
-1

Si eres bueno buscad lo bueno

Imagen de ziscko
+1
0
-1

Me funcionó de maravilla, sólo que en mi caso me mostraba la unidad sda.
Gracias!

+1
0
-1
Imagen de pejeno
+1
0
-1

No se si sea cierto lo que comenta Leolo para los ficheros encriptados y los comprimidos, y con respecto a los permisos y los propietarios, dudo que se puedan cambiar en Linux. NTFS-3G solo sirve para poder escribir. El unico problema que he tenido con ese driver es que al momento de modificar archivos (de texto que uso para guardar registros de lo que hago, no he probado a modificar nada mas) Gedit me dice que no se puede guardar los cambios. Asi que no me queda de otra mas que guardar con otro nombre en mi particion NTFS y borrar despues el original. Con lo de no poder montar mas de una partición, si se puede. Yo tengo montadas 3 particiones en modo lectura-escritura y no he tenido problema alguno.

+1
0
-1
Imagen de darkcabrito
+1
0
-1

Que tal Eleesban, yo tambien tuve ese problema y lo solucione de la siguiente forma sin necesidad de bajar nada, te explico:

Crea una carpeta por ejemplo "C" en donde quieras (esta servira como punto de montaje), ahora abre una consola y ejecuta sudo gedit /etc/fstab , una vez abierto si quieres motar la primera particion de tu primer disco duro escribe esto
/dev/hda1 /home/tu_usuario/Desktop/C ntfs-3g silent,umask=0,locale=es_AR.utf8 0 0 (checa que /home/tu_usuario/Desktop/C es la ruta de la carpeta que yo hice como punto de montaje), cierra el fstab guardando los cambios y reinicia el equipo para que lo monte al iniciar, y eso seria todo, a mi me funciono y puedo checar mi info sin ningun problema.

Como comentario para reproducir videos de cierto formato como divx o algun otro tienes que bajar los libs necesarios al igual que si deseas reproducir musica mp3, checa en el foro, hay mas post al respecto.

Todo lo que tiene un principio... tiene un final, la virtud es saber aceptarlo...

+1
0
-1

Todo lo que tiene un principio... tiene un final, la virtud es saber aceptarlo...

Imagen de Eleesban
+1
0
-1

Gracias por la respuesta, voy a probar con esto que parece más sencillo, aunque supongo q con esta opción no puedes escribir en las particiones ntfs.
un saludo

+1
0
-1
Imagen de laisa
+1
0
-1

alguien sabe cómo se pueden ver los archivos encriptados en ntfs? yo tengo el ntfs-3g, y puedo leer y escribir en las particiones ntfs bastante bien, pero no puedo ver todos los archivos y las carpetas. por ahora, la solución que encontré es seguir usando windows, y/o pasarlos a un disco de intercambio... pero me gustaría algo más definitivo (no sé si se podrá)
saludos
laisa

+1
0
-1
Imagen de gatitabast
+1
0
-1

En mi caso, el disco duro ntfs lo tengo por usb. Cuando lo he conectado a otro ordenador con windows, me dice que formatee (cosa que no quiero hacer, la informacion dentro del disco es importante) Y cuando lo conecto en Ubuntu 11.10 me sale lo siguiente:
Error mounting: mount exited with exit code 13: ntfs_attr_pread_i: ntfs_pread failed: Input/output error
Failed to read NTFS $Bitmap: Input/output error
NTFS is either inconsistent, or there is a hardware fault, or it's a
SoftRAID/FakeRAID hardware. In the first case run chkdsk /f on Windows
then reboot into Windows twice. The usage of the /f parameter is very
important! If the device is a SoftRAID/FakeRAID then first activate
it and mount a different device under the /dev/mapper/ directory, (e.g.
/dev/mapper/nvidia_eahaabcc1). Please see the 'dmraid' documentation
for more details.

Con el fin de proteger la informacion del disco duro, ¿podrian decirme si este tutorial vale tambien en este caso?

+1
0
-1
Imagen de Gabriel_M
+1
0
-1

Este tutorial es antiguo, ntfs-3g esta super maduro e integrado al sistema.
Tienes un error de sistema de archivos o de disco.
Haz lo que Gnu/Linux sabiamente te aconseja:
run chkdsk /f on Windows
Corre chkdsk /f desde MsWindows, para intentar corregir el problema.

+1
0
-1
Imagen de gatitabast
+1
0
-1

Enchufe a un ordenador windows, hice chkdsk /f y salieron un monton de fallos. Ya esta el disco duro arreglado y funcionando perfectamente en Ubuntu.
Muchas gracias!!

+1
0
-1